In a recent revelation, Akansha Ranjan, known for her connections in the film industry as the daughter of producer Shashi Ranjan and sister of actress Anushka Ranjan, has firmly asserted her determination to establish herself in the industry solely based on her own merit.
Addressing speculations surrounding her family’s influence and her friendships with prominent actors like Alia Bhatt, Ranjan clarified that she refuses to leverage her connections for professional opportunities. Emphasizing her father’s unrealized acting aspirations and her own ethos of self-reliance, she stated, “I want to be able to make it on my own.”
Ranjan, who recently appeared in the web film “Monica O My Darling,” expressed her belief in individual success, affirming her readiness to seize her own spotlight after celebrating her friends’ achievements. Additionally, she revealed plans for her Telugu debut, marking a significant milestone in her career trajectory.
On a more personal note, rumors have swirled regarding her romantic involvement with director Sharan Sharma, known for his work on “Gunjan Saxena: The Kargil Girl.” Confirming the speculation, Ranjan admitted to being in a relationship with Sharma but maintained her preference for privacy regarding her personal life.
